48 lines
2.0 KiB
Plaintext
48 lines
2.0 KiB
Plaintext
/dts-v1/;
|
|
/plugin/;
|
|
|
|
/ {
|
|
fragment@0 {
|
|
target-path = "/";
|
|
__overlay__ {
|
|
imx586_xvclk: imx586-xvclk {
|
|
compatible = "fixed-clock";
|
|
#clock-cells = <0>;
|
|
clock-frequency = <24000000>;
|
|
clock-output-names = "imx586_xvclk";
|
|
};
|
|
};
|
|
};
|
|
|
|
fragment@1 {
|
|
target = <&i2c3>;
|
|
|
|
__overlay__ {
|
|
status = "okay";
|
|
|
|
imx586: imx586@34 {
|
|
compatible = "sony,imx586";
|
|
reg = <0x34>;
|
|
clocks = <&imx586_xvclk>;
|
|
clock-names = "xvclk";
|
|
reset-gpios = <&gpio3 9 0>; /* GPIO_ACTIVE_LOW */
|
|
pwdn-gpios = <&gpio3 11 1>; /* GPIO_ACTIVE_HIGH */
|
|
avdd-supply = <&vcc_3v3_s0>;
|
|
dovdd-supply = <&vcc_1v8_s0>;
|
|
dvdd-supply = <&avdd_1v2_s0>;
|
|
rockchip,camera-module-index = <1>;
|
|
rockchip,camera-module-facing = "back";
|
|
rockchip,camera-module-name = "CIS-IMX586";
|
|
rockchip,camera-module-lens-name = "CHT842B-MD";
|
|
status = "okay";
|
|
|
|
port {
|
|
imx586_out: endpoint {
|
|
remote-endpoint = <&mipi_in_imx586>;
|
|
data-lanes = <1 2 3 4>;
|
|
};
|
|
};
|
|
};
|
|
};
|
|
};
|
|
}; |